VLamax correlates strongly with glycolytic Performance

VLamax estimates an athlete`s maximal glycolytic rate. This study aimed to determine the relationships between VLamax and cycle ergometry efforts with a high glycolytic energy contribution and the influence of VLamax and VO2max on the respiratory compensation point. Eleven national-to-international endurance cyclists (VO2max = 70.7 ± 5.9 ml·kg-1·min-1) completed a 15-s isokinetic test with pre- and post-lactate measurements to determine VLamax, a 1-min maximal effort, and a ramp test to exhaustion in a single test session. The main findings showed strong relationships between VLamax and the mean absolute (r = 0.83, p = .002) and relative (r = 0.88, p = .0004) power during the lactic interval of the 15-s isokinetic test. This relationship weakened when comparing VLamax with mean absolute (r = 0.52, p = .098) and relative (r = 0.29, p = .393) power during a 1-min maximal effort. Combining the VLamax and VO2max data through multiple regression resulted in a positive effect on the estimation of the respiratory compensation point. It was concluded that VLamax is a relevant indicator of maximal glycolytic rate. However, this metric currently lacks scientific validation as an accurate estimate of glycolytic rate and provides minimal extra information over using the power output from the isokinetic test alone. Practitioners may simply measure power over glycolytically demanding efforts to understand the maximal glycolytic rate of their athletes.
